1. What is Microsoft 365 E3 in Microsoft?
Microsoft 365 E3 includes core Office apps like Word, Excel, and PowerPoint, along with entry-level security features such as identity and access management, endpoint detection, and compliance tools. It is a strong foundation, but not a complete cybersecurity solution. Additional tools are needed to close the gaps.
2. What is the difference between E3 and E5?
E5 adds advanced security, compliance, and analytics features not included in E3. This includes tools like Microsoft Sentinel and extended threat protection. It also comes at a higher cost, typically around 57 dollars per user compared to 35 for E3.

4. Does Microsoft E3 include Microsoft Defender?
Only partially. E3 includes a basic version of Microsoft Defender with anti-malware, device control, and firewall tools. To unlock full functionality, you’ll need additional licensing or a dedicated security platform like Heimdal.
